Volleyball Recap: Fort Wayne Canterbury Cavaliers vs. Bremen Lions
After having lost a blowout in their previous game against Whitko, Fort Wayne Canterbury was happy to have turned things around on Saturday. They walked away with a 2-0 win over the Bremen Lions. The Cavaliers were shut out 2-0 the last time they took on the Lions, so the Cavaliers were just returning the favor.

Caroline Hirschy had a dynamite game, getting 18 digs and two aces. That's the most digs she has posted over her last six matchups.
Fort Wayne Canterbury has been performing well recently as they've won five of their last six matches. That's provided a nice bump to their 15-7 record this season. As for Bremen, their defeat dropped their record down to 20-8.
Fort Wayne Canterbury w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next contest, a 2-1 loss against Elkhart Christian Academy on the 4th. As for Bremen, they also did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next matchup, a 2-0 victory against Bethany Christian on the 4th.
